KEY JOB PURPOSE

 Monitor, coordinate, and manage compliance to slaughterhouse quality assurance, health, and safety activities to ensure products, services, and the work environment meets the required operating requirements in terms of quality/food safety and OHS, in support of the achievement of business objectives.

 The QA Head is required to:

  • Do a walk-through of the lab, work stations, and the plant on a daily basis to monitor a range of operational compliances, housekeeping, and work environment.
  • Support continuous improvement of best practice, and gather and share learnings with the slaughterhouse team, process owners, and process areas wherever possible.
  • Demonstrate a high level of ability to identify and resolve problems and prevent recurrence wherever possible. This includes the ability to determine root causes and symptoms of problems, and make sound decisions in the resolution.

 ORGANISATIONAL CHART

 The quality assurance head is a member of the slaughterhouse middle management team and is supervised by the slaughterhouse leadership and technically will report to the central quality and food safety head. The role is responsible for driving all activities related to quality assurance and OHS, and with ensuring that company’s quality and food safety policies are effectively implemented and practiced for delivering best products and services at all times and continually improve the performance.

 KEY OUTPUTS AND ACCOUNTABILITIES

Build and manage strategic QA understanding

  • Understand the meat processing techniques/science/requirements and management systems in order to advise production management on possible issues on the quality of the product
  • Authorities to correct / manage non-compliances inline within established procedures and operating requirements
  • Escalate quality issues to the leadership and Quality & Food Safety Head when necessary and whenever required
  • Ensure the alignment of quality control with the Supply Chain Way principles and work practices
  • Update and follow operating requirements as per the integrated management systems in place
  • Will perform any quality, food safety, and or OHS related activity when told to do by the supervisor

 Drive quality assurance improvement in the slaughterhouse and plant operations

  • Interpret standards, requirements and specifications for the relevant environment e.g., processing lines and units, water treatment, & final product
  • Identify non-conformances and communicate to relevant personnel for corrective action
  • Conduct statistical process control (SPC) studies according to the procedure and tools

 Maintain safety, health and environment standards

  • Comply with safe working procedures / signage and standards
  • Propose personal protective equipment and use and maintain this in accordance with procedures and legislation
  • Carry out work according to relevant Environment, Health and Safety standards

Job Requirements

QUALIFICATIONS AND EXPERIENCE

  • Minimum requirement: Doctor of Veterinary medicine or related field.
  • Experience: Six years of relevant work experience in meat processing facilities out of which, least 3 years of managerial exposure in a quality assurance role.
